IMLS Funding Opportunities and Updates: 2012

Home / Project Briefing Pages / CNI Fall 2011 Project Briefings / IMLS Funding Opportunities and Updates: 2012

December 7, 2011

Chuck Thomas
Senior Program Officer
Institute of Museum and Library Services

The Institute of Museum and Library Services (IMLS) is the primary source of federal support for the nation’s 123,000 libraries and 17,500 museums. Its mission is to create strong libraries and museums that connect people to information and ideas. This session will focus on funding opportunities for 2012, including new updates and changes to grant programs. The session will include an overview of recent developments, such as the new IMLS strategic plan, new partnerships and agency priorities.
